Abstract: 

 

There are more than 100,000 natural and synthetic chemicals used in households, industry and agriculture, and there is growing evidence that a significant number of chemicals in medicine, personal care products and household items known to be endocrine disrupting compounds (EDCs) are not effectively treated by today’s conventional wastewater and water treatment plants. The potential risk of chronic exposure to EDCs in humans has not been adequately addressed to date, but their effects on normal hormonal processes are well documented and there is strong evidence of their adverse effects in wildlife. The goal of this project is to develop an advanced ozone membrane process for treatment of these low-level but potent pollutants. The technology synergistically combines the only three known technologies that show promise in treating broad spectrum EDC pollutants, i.e., (1) ozone oxidation, (2) adsorption and (3) membrane separation to establish a compact and efficient treatment unit that could be applied for both household use and in large-scale drinking water treatment plants. Deliverables:

1.  An advanced ozone membrane process that uses membranes as the ozone distributor,reaction contactor and water separator to concentrate, capture and destroy endocrine disrupting compounds found in water

2. A porous membrane for ozone distributor that enhances mass transfer rate by at least 50% compared to glass sparger

3.A membrane separator to concentrate the EDC pollutants by permeating clean water (i.e., < 1 ppm TOCs)

4. An adsorbent coating for membrane contactor based on safe and environmentally benign mineral clay for capture of EDCs and EDCs degradates 

5.An advanced ozone membrane prototype unit designed to convert target EDCs by   greater than 95 % and degrade by at least 90 %

6.Design a prototype unit for domestic household use and test performance for at least 60 days

7. Use process simulation software to design a scale-up advanced ozone membrane unit for drinking water treatment plant
